I might be interested in helping to extend the wrapper for more of the
HMMER3 toolkit. In particular hmmsearch might be relevant, which
is designed for one (or a few) profiles vs. a big seq database while
hmmscan is designed for one (or a few) sequences vs. a big profile
database. See http://selab.janelia.org/people/eddys/blog/?p=424
